How Many Positions Are There In Kamasutra

The Kamasutra is an ancient Indian text that has been a subject of fascination for many people around the world. Written by Vatsyayana, this book is not just about sex, but also about relationships, intimacy, and pleasure. One of the most popular aspects of the Kamasutra is its description of various sexual positions, which has led to a lot of curiosity and speculation about the number of positions it actually describes.
A Brief Introduction to the Kamasutra
The Kamasutra is an ancient Indian text that was written in the 2nd century CE. It is a comprehensive guide to living a fulfilling life, with a focus on relationships, intimacy, and pleasure. The book is divided into seven chapters, each of which deals with a different aspect of human relationships. The Kamasutra is not just about sex, but also about how to build and maintain strong relationships, how to communicate with your partner, and how to achieve intimacy and pleasure.
One of the most interesting aspects of the Kamasutra is its description of various sexual positions. The book describes a total of 64 arts, which include singing, dancing, and music, as well as various sexual positions. The Benefits of the Kamasutra
The Kamasutra has been widely read and studied for centuries, and its benefits are numerous. Some of the benefits of reading the Kamasutra include:
- Improved relationships: The Kamasutra provides advice on how to build and maintain strong relationships, which can lead to greater intimacy and pleasure.
- Increased intimacy: The book's description of various sexual positions and techniques can help couples to increase their intimacy and pleasure.
- Greater self-awareness: The Kamasutra encourages readers to explore their own desires and needs, which can lead to greater self-awareness and self-acceptance.
In addition to its benefits for relationships and intimacy, the Kamasutra is also a fascinating and insightful look at ancient Indian culture and society. The book provides a unique glimpse into the values and attitudes of ancient India, and its description of various arts and sciences is still relevant today.
